Swedish marintech company Zparq has launched a new OEM electric propulsion system designed for industrial marine use, marking a significant step in the company’s development and reinforcing the growing role of electric solutions in advanced maritime applications.
Zparq has introduced an ultra-light 10 kW submersible motor weighing just 4 kg, enabling boat manufacturers to integrate electric propulsion systems without compromising vessel design. The system is built for direct integration into hulls, allowing for more flexible and compact vessel architectures.
This approach opens up new possibilities for applications such as maritime surveillance, subsea inspection, security operations and autonomous craft. By embedding propulsion within the hull, the system enables new vessel configurations and supports emerging segments, including hydrofoil-based and unmanned platforms.
The propulsion solution also includes a complete zero-emission system offering – covering batteries, power electronics, control units and software – tailored for industrial integration.
Advancing electric propulsion for industrial and strategic marine use
The new OEM system builds on Zparq’s earlier outboard technology but has been re-engineered into a modular platform suited for industrial requirements, where reliability, performance and adaptability are critical.
The company has already secured initial orders from established OEM customers, signalling early market validation. The system is pressure-tested for both submerged and surface applications and offers a low acoustic signature, making it suitable for operations where efficiency and discretion are essential.
